Synopsis
The Trial of Lee Harvey Oswald, a 1977 film starring Ben Gazzara, explores the hypothetical trial that never took place for the alleged assassin of President John F. Kennedy. The movie delves into the intricacies of the legal system as it imagines the courtroom drama that could have surrounded one of the most significant events in American history. With its gripping performances and thought-provoking narrative, the film challenges viewers to consider the complexities of justice, conspiracy, and the impact of individual actions on a nation. The Trial of Lee Harvey Oswald takes audiences on a tense and riveting journey through the shadowy corridors of power and intrigue.

Reviews
The Trial of Lee Harvey Oswald has garnered mixed reviews from critics and audiences alike. While some commend the film for its bold examination of a controversial subject matter, others criticize its speculative nature and lack of concrete evidence. Rotten Tomatoes gives the movie a rating of 67%, with some reviewers praising Ben Gazzara's powerhouse performance while others find the film's pacing to be slow and ponderous. IMDb users have rated the movie at 6.7/10, with opinions ranging from engaging courtroom drama to a missed opportunity in exploring the conspiracy theories surrounding Kennedy's assassination. Metacritic scores the film at 65%, reflecting the diverse range of opinions on this provocative piece of cinema.
